A Multicenter, Double-Blind, Active-Controlled, Parallel Group Study to Examine the Safety, Tolerability and Efficacy of Oral MK-0974 for the Long Term Treatment of Acute Migraine With or Without Aura
In Brief
A Phase 3 clinical trial evaluating Telcagepant 300 mg soft gel capsules, Telcagepant 280 mg tablets, and 4 other interventions for Migraine. Completed, enrolled 1,068 participants.
Detailed Summary
The purpose of this study is to investigate the safety and tolerability of telcagepant (MK-0974) in the long-term treatment of acute migraine in adult participants. The primary hypothesis of this study is that telcagepant is well tolerated in the long-term treatment of acute migraine in adult participants.
